Finland Receives Fifty iGaming Licence Applications Ahead of 2027 Market Launch

Finland has received 50 licence applications for its upcoming iGaming market, scheduled for launch in 2027, according to igamingbusiness.

By FinlandGambling.com Editorial · 14 Jun 2026

Fifty licence applications have been submitted in Finland in anticipation of the regulated iGaming market launch in 2027. This development indicates significant industry interest in the forthcoming Finnish licensing regime.
